#6bdfde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6bdfde is composed of 42% red, 87.5% green and 87.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52% cyan, 0% magenta, 0.4%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 179.5 degrees, a saturation of 64.4% and a lightness of 64.7%. #6bdfde color hex could be obtained by blending #d6ffff with #00bfbd.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

#6bdfde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6bdfde has RGB values of R:107, G:223, B:222 and CMYK values of C:0.52, M:0, Y:0,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 7069662.

Shades and Tints of #6bdfde
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030d0d is the darkest color, while #fcfef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#6bdfde
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a2a8a8 is the less saturated color, while #4ffbf9 is the most saturated one.
